garycq wrote:
I have a 30' 5th wheel and pull it with my Dodge diesel truck. The rear end gearing is 4:10 and the trans is an automatic which has been rebuilt for heavy towing. I was told recently by an experienced RVer that I should never tow my 5'ver in over drive. I usually tow at 55mph or less and I do use over drive on level highways. He told me he has torn up a couple of trans by using overdrive. I was curious about other peoples experience about towing with an automatic. When going up any grade the over drive goes off.
Thanks
Gary
Seems to be more of a 1500 or gasser problem, not so much with a diesel. My 08 dodge is the same as the Fords, no overdrive, but hit tow-haul to hold gears longer and downshift sooner. I do not know if this holds true with your 01 Dodge. You will get a better answer if you head over to Cumminsforum.com
